Okay, in order to answer this question, let's state why viruses are not considered living organisms.
00:08
Okay, first remember that the structure of a virus is going to have a genetic material, okay? it is going to have also, which is going to be the capsid, okay, the capsid.
00:19
And some of them have an envelope that is made of the cell membrane, they invade.
00:26
Okay, and well, they are going to have also some enzymes here and like proteins on the cell.
00:31
Surface, but this is a general structure, a genetic material or a genome that can be rna or dna, a capsid, and well, envelop sometimes.
00:43
So what properties or what characteristics of viruses does not make them living organisms? well, the first one is going to be that viruses are not made out of cells.
00:56
Okay, so they don't have cells because, and well, this is why it is because they don't have organelles, okay? they just only have a capsule and a genome, okay? they don't have a nucleus, a ribosone, they don't have any of that.
01:12
So, practically, they can't keep themselves in a stable state, homeostasis, because this is achieved by many cells organelles.
01:22
Okay? and obviously they are not going to grow because they don't have the machinery or the same machinery to replicate themselves.
01:31
Another characteristic of this is that viruses cannot make their own energy or reproduce on their own.
01:38
Okay, and particularly they are going to require a host, like humans, for example, or animals, okay? so they can make atp or their own atp without the use of a host, okay? because they don't have a mitochondria, for example, or enzymes to, or they can, like, get nutrients for them, for, from their environment in order to do metabolism.
